Subject: Handover — stuck exports on Quillhaven

Hey Marisol,

Quick handover before I log off. The nightly exports from the Quillhaven reporting cluster failed twice — looks like the retry queue filled up after that storage blip. I've cleared the dead-letter entries, so just rerun the export job and watch the first batch. If it stalls again, bump the timeout to 120s. Connect to the replica using the string below.

replica DSN, kajep-yahag: mssql://praok_svc:iF@db-8d68.plorvaio.local:5432/eliion

## Changelog — Marrowlint 3.1

Changed defaults: the static-analysis baseline file is now generated automatically on first run instead of requiring a manual bootstrap. Existing baselines are respected; delete yours only if you want a fresh one. New findings outside the baseline fail the build. Contractors: don't edit the baseline by hand. The new default settings shipped in 3.1 are listed below.

deployment values, yadug-bawif:
[framir]
team = pelox
access_code = ac_a38ab2
owner = tamion.julael
host = framir.tolvaqlabs.test
port = 11211
peer = tammir.zemvargrid.local
salt = 2215ef03
pin = 1541

Board Briefing — Big-Deal Discounts at Quillard & Mosse

Quick read before Thursday's session: our large-deal discounting has drifted. Sales reps can currently stack the volume tier with the loyalty rebate, and on a few Pellton contracts that added up to nearly 30% off list. We're proposing a hard cap at 20% with CFO sign-off above that. Expected margin recovery is modest but real. The underlying plan is summarized below.

confidential, kagup-bafog: Fraaxax Group is in early talks to buy Soroxox Group for about $343.8 million. The Olidor launch date is June 14, and nothing goes to the press before then. Legal wants the Aldmirek Logistics term sheet signed before July 23.

## Deployment

Heads up, plugin folks: Crispin images are slim now. We strip build toolchains, docs, and locales from the final layer, so if your plugin needs anything beyond the base runtime, vendor it in your own stage. Multi-stage builds only — fat images get rejected by CI. The slim runtime ships with the following defaults.

config for bafog-kafog:
wenix:
  log_level: debug
  metrics_host: metrics.wenix.zemvarlabs.internal
  pin: 3500
  pool_size: 16